(1):

(n.) An unaccompanied part song for three or more solo voices. It is not necessarily gleesome.

(2):

(n.) Music; minstrelsy; entertainment.

(3):

(n.) Joy; merriment; mirth; gayety; paricularly, the mirth enjoyed at a feast.
